2024年6月2日发(作者:)
服务器配置管理中的自动化部署和自动化运
维
随着互联网的发展,服务器的数量和功能不断增加,传统的手动配
置和维护已经无法满足需求。在服务器配置管理中,自动化部署和自
动化运维成为了越来越重要的环节。本文将介绍服务器配置管理以及
自动化部署和运维的概念、流程和优势。
一、服务器配置管理概述
服务器配置管理是指对服务器硬件、软件和网络等方面的配置进行
有效管理和调整的过程。它包括服务器的安装、配置、更新、监控和
维护等方面。服务器配置管理的目标是实现配置的一致性和高效性,
降低管理成本,提高系统的可靠性和稳定性。
二、自动化部署概念与流程
自动化部署是指利用自动化技术,快速、准确地部署服务器的过程。
下面将介绍自动化部署的基本概念和流程。
1. 自动化部署的概念
自动化部署是通过编写脚本和使用工具,实现批量而自动化地安装
和配置操作系统、软件和应用程序的过程。它能够提高部署的效率和
准确性,降低部署过程中的错误率。
2. 自动化部署的流程
自动化部署的流程主要包括以下几个步骤:
1)准备环境:确定服务器的硬件和网络环境,并进行必要的准备
工作,如安装操作系统。
2)编写脚本:编写相应的脚本,包括操作系统的安装和配置、软
件的安装和配置等内容。
3)执行脚本:使用工具执行编写好的脚本,自动化完成服务器的
安装和配置过程。
4)测试和验证:对部署完成的服务器进行测试和验证,确保配置
的正确性和可用性。
5)文档记录:记录部署的过程和配置的详情,为后续的维护和升
级提供参考。
三、自动化运维概念与流程
自动化运维是指利用自动化技术,对服务器进行监控、管理和维护
的过程。下面将介绍自动化运维的基本概念和流程。
1. 自动化运维的概念
自动化运维是通过使用工具和脚本,对服务器进行监控、管理和维
护的过程。它能够提高运维的效率和可靠性,减少人为操作的错误和
工作量。
2. 自动化运维的流程
自动化运维的流程主要包括以下几个步骤:
1)监控服务器:使用监控工具对服务器的硬件和软件资源进行监
控,实时获取服务器的状态信息。
2)告警和预警:对监控到的异常情况进行告警和预警,便于及时
处理问题并避免可能的故障。
3)自动化管理:使用工具和脚本进行服务器的管理操作,如添加
用户、配置网络等。
4)故障处理:自动化运维工具可以自动检测和处理一些常见的故
障,提高故障处理的效率。
5)日志和报告:自动化运维工具能够自动生成运维日志和报告,
方便管理人员进行分析和评估。
四、自动化部署和运维的优势
自动化部署和运维具有如下优势:
1. 提高效率:自动化部署和运维能够减少人为操作的工作量,提高
工作效率。
2. 降低错误率:自动化工具能够快速准确地执行脚本,减少人为操
作带来的错误。
3. 可追溯性:自动化部署和运维能够记录配置和操作的细节,方便
后续的追溯和问题排查。
4. 一致性:自动化工具能够保证不同服务器之间配置的一致性,减
少配置冲突和差异带来的问题。
5. 实时监控:自动化运维工具能够实时监控服务器的状态,及时发
现和处理问题,提高系统可用性。
总结:
随着服务器数量和功能的不断增加,服务器配置管理中的自动化部
署和运维成为了必不可少的环节。自动化部署能够高效、准确地部署
服务器,提高工作效率和配置一致性;自动化运维能够实时监控和管
理服务器,降低故障发生的概率和处理的成本。通过引入自动化技术,
可以为服务器配置管理带来更高的效率和可靠性。
发布者:admin,转转请注明出处:http://www.yc00.com/web/1717278626a2736327.html
评论列表(0条)